Lucknow petrol pump owners to end strike

Lucknow: The Lucknow petrol pump owners would end their strike at 12 pm on Tuesday after an action from the Government. The strike came after raids at petrol pumps by Uttar Pradesh STF after orders from Chief Minister Yogi Adityanath. The petrol pump owners faced red from the STF after they were caught red-handed be-fooling people and stealing fuel. In the recent raids done by Lucknow STF, it was found that petrol pump owners were inserting a chip-like device inside their petrol dispensing machines and fooling the consumers by selling them less fuel for the same price. The raids were conducted on around 15-16 petrol pumps and 13 pumps were seized in the raids. As per reports,  the decision of strike came into force as UP Petrol Pump Association’s Chief BN Shukla was facing major setback after STF strikes as  three of the petrol pumps owned by his son were seized in the raids. Soon after the seizure of these petrol pumps, a meeting was held on Monday night where it was decided that a strike would be called by all the petrol pumps. As per reports, the strike has been called to create a pressure on STF as people are ought to suffer due to the strikes by petrol pumps of the city.
